Producer – (Long-Form Video Content)
General Description:
The Houston Rockets are seeking a passionate and talented Video Producer ready to work in a fast- paced and creative production environment. This role will work closely with the Directors, Managers and video production team to establish the most engaging Rockets team long-form content.
RESPONSIBILITIES include but are not limited to:
• Demonstrate our One Team philosophy of Passion, Accountability, Customer Focus, and Teamwork.
• Collaboration: Work closely with marketing and production team to build compelling video content for Rockets fans and our partners.
• Content Creation: Produce high-quality video content covering various aspects of the Houston Rockets, including game highlights, player profiles, team history, and current storylines.
• Have a high-level understanding of ideation, storyboards, and pitching ideas that are within budget, on time, and on brand.
• Storytelling: Develop compelling narratives and storylines that captivate our audience and provide insight into the team's journey, both on and off the court.
• Able to concept original ideas, take requests, work with existing footage, and create highly produced pieces.
• Use storytelling skills to produce one 30-minute documentary, one monthly all-access docuseries in-season (8 ep. at 8-12 min per), one bi-weekly podcast series in-season event-based (~20 ep. at 15-20 min per), one off-season episodic TBD
• Research: Stay up to date with the latest news, trends, and developments surrounding the Houston Rockets and the NBA, including past achievements, key moments, and current roster dynamics.
• Editing: Edit and enhance video footage using industry-standard editing software, adding graphics, music, and other elements to elevate the quality of the final product.
• Understand color correction, audio mastering, and use of different codecs.
• Help build/log/maintain digital video library.
• Shooting: Plan and execute video shoots that support long form content including interviews and high production value broll.
• Feedback & Improvement: Solicit feedback from stakeholders and audience members to continually refine and improve the quality of our video content and storytelling.
• Ability to work both independently and in a collaborative environment.
M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:
• Bachelor's degree from an accredited college/university with major coursework in film/broadcast/communications or equal experience.
• A minimum of 5 years of producing experience for a sports team or post house.
• Proficiency in video editing software – Adobe Premiere Pro, and Adobe Creative Cloud
• Excellent interpersonal, verbal/written communication and organizational skills.
• Ability to work nights, weekends and holidays required as needed.
• Live production/control experience a plus.
• Ability to prioritize and handle multiple assignments under pressure.
• Comfortable working in a fast paced, time-sensitive department
• Ability to assist in shooting a plus
• Some travel may be required
